Fabrication of germanium-coated nickel hollow waveguides for infrared transmission

Abstract

Circular hollow nickel waveguides with an inner germanium layer are fabricated by using a method based on rf sputtering, plating, and etching techniques. Transmission losses less than 0.5 dB are achieved including launching losses for straight waveguides with 1.5 mmφ×1 m at 10.6-μm wavelength. Bending losses of the waveguides are also examined.
